Technology-enhanced math learning tools comprise digital platforms, software, apps, and interactive resources designed to facilitate, enrich, and personalize mathematics education. They incorporate features such as interactive exercises, visualizations, adaptive learning algorithms, and gamification to improve engagement, understanding, and retention of mathematical concepts across various educational levels.
Key Features
- Interactive problem-solving exercises
- Adaptive learning pathways tailored to individual progress
- Visualizations of complex mathematical concepts
- Gamification elements to motivate learners
- Real-time feedback and assessment tools
- Accessibility for diverse learning needs
- Integration with classroom curricula and LMS platforms
Pros
- Enhances student engagement through interactive and game-based elements
- Provides personalized learning experiences and targeted feedback
- Makes abstract mathematical concepts more concrete via visualizations
- Facilitates self-paced learning outside traditional classrooms
- Supports diverse learning styles and accessibility needs
Cons
- Quality and effectiveness can vary significantly across different tools
- Potential overreliance on technology at the expense of foundational skills
- May require substantial training for educators to integrate effectively
- Access issues due to cost or digital divide in certain regions
- Risk of distracting features that detract from focused learning
